5 Facts you should know about
PLCG2-associated Antibody Deficiency and Immune Dysregulation (PLAID)
1
An allergic response to cold, called cold urticaria, is the most distinct symptom
2
The allergic response to cold likely results from abnormal activation of immune cells at low temperatures
3
Additionally, some individuals with PLAID can develop a burn-like rash at birth in areas most likely to be exposed to cold temperatures, such as the nose
4
Also typical are recurrent bacterial infections and an increased likelihood of developing autoimmune disorders
5
Another common symptom is a burning sensation in the throat when eating cold food
